What does a senior logistics manager do?

A senior logistics manager oversees the planning, implementation, and coordination of an organization’s supply chain operations, including transportation, inventory management, and warehousing. They analyze logistics data, optimize processes for efficiency, and ensure timely delivery of goods, often using logistics software and managing teams. Strong organizational, problem-solving skills and industry certifications are typically required for this role.

What are the 7 C's of logistics?

The 7 C's of logistics are a framework for effective supply chain management, including Customer, Cost, Convenience, Communication, Coordination, Control, and Continuous improvement. As a Senior Logistics Manager, understanding these principles helps optimize operations, improve service levels, and reduce costs within the logistics process.

What is the difference between Senior Logistics Manager vs Logistics Coordinator?

AspectSenior Logistics ManagerLogistics Coordinator
CredentialsBachelor's degree in Supply Chain, Logistics, or Business; often requires experience in management rolesAssociate's or Bachelor's degree; entry-level certifications may be preferred
Work EnvironmentOversees logistics operations, manages teams, and develops strategies in corporate or distribution settingsCoordinates shipments, tracks deliveries, and communicates with vendors in warehouse or office settings
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by large companies, manufacturing, and distribution firmsCommon in retail, manufacturing, and shipping companies

The main difference is that a Senior Logistics Manager has strategic and leadership responsibilities, overseeing entire logistics operations, while a Logistics Coordinator handles day-to-day shipment coordination and communication. The Senior Logistics Manager role requires more experience and higher-level decision-making, whereas the Logistics Coordinator focuses on operational tasks.

Astrion has an exciting opportunity for a Senior Logistics Manager to support the Cryptologic and Cyber Systems Division (AFLCMC/HNC) located at the Lackland AFB in San Antonio Texas.

RE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S / SKILLS:

  • Must be a US citizen
  • Active TS/SCI clearance required;
  • Bachelor’s Degree in Logistics Management, Business or related degree
  • Minimum 2+ years working with acquisition requirements, development and approval processes with at least 3+ years in the DoD environment
  • Experience working with an Agile team and Cybersecurity missions is a plus

RESPONSIBILITIES:

Duties include but not limited to

  • Apply knowledge of the acquisition lifecycle and product support planning during each phase.
  • Work both independently and as part of a collaborative project team.
  • Proficient Microsoft office skills: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Access, Visio, and Project.
  • Apply defense acquisition management processes in accordance with the DoD 5000.
  • Provide DoD integrated product support element structure in accordance with the DoD Product Support Manager Guidebook.
  • Manage the Product Support Business Case Analysis (PS-BCA) and Life Cycle Sustainment Plan (LCSP) processes.
  • Leverage department/agency policies and procedures related to the implementation and management of government-furnished equipment (GFE) for program success.
  • Conducts inventory and tracking of accountable property according to department policies and procedures
  • Ability to integrate and support a project team in completing complex projects.
  • Contributes to program planning, funding, and management of information systems.
  • Coordinate and evaluate the efforts of functional specialists to identify specific requirements and to develop and adjust plans and schedules for the actions needed to meet each requirement on time.
  • Integrate separate functions in planning or implementing a logistics management program.
  • Other duties as assigned
